UPDATE

So couple of jobs today on the back of the trophy

One being the easy job of the rear number plate not working, suspected bulb blown. So bought new lamp, refreshing it up at the same time..

DSC_0372.JPG

DSC_0373.JPG

DSC_0374.JPG


And another common problem is the boot struts seem to fail leaving you with a limp boot that doesn't stay up.. Bought some 1 series struts which worked, lovely jubbly.

DSC_0371.JPG


Rare trophy boot status achieved..

DSC_0375.JPG


Just the exhaust to do and all will be peachy.
